TIMER Dead Time Insertion (DTI) initialization structure.
Field Documentation
◆ enable
| bool TIMER_InitDTI_TypeDef::enable |
Enable DTI or leave it disabled until TIMER_EnableDTI() is called.
◆ activeLowOut
| bool TIMER_InitDTI_TypeDef::activeLowOut |
DTI Output Polarity.
◆ invertComplementaryOut
| bool TIMER_InitDTI_TypeDef::invertComplementaryOut |
DTI Complementary Output Invert.
◆ autoRestart
| bool TIMER_InitDTI_TypeDef::autoRestart |
Enable Automatic Start-up functionality (when debugger exits).
◆ enablePrsSource
| bool TIMER_InitDTI_TypeDef::enablePrsSource |
Enable/disable PRS as DTI input.
◆ prsSel
| TIMER_PRSSEL_TypeDef TIMER_InitDTI_TypeDef::prsSel |
Select which PRS channel as DTI input.
Only valid if
enablePrsSource
is enabled.
◆ prescale
| TIMER_Prescale_TypeDef TIMER_InitDTI_TypeDef::prescale |
DTI prescaling factor, if HFPER / HFPERB clock used.
◆ riseTime
| unsigned int TIMER_InitDTI_TypeDef::riseTime |
DTI Rise Time.
◆ fallTime
| unsigned int TIMER_InitDTI_TypeDef::fallTime |
DTI Fall Time.
◆ outputsEnableMask
| uint32_t TIMER_InitDTI_TypeDef::outputsEnableMask |
DTI outputs enable bit mask, consisting of one bit per DTI output signal, i.e., CC0, CC1, CC2, CDTI0, CDTI1, and CDTI2.
This value should consist of one or more TIMER_DTOGEN_DTOGnnnEN flags (defined in <part_name>_timer.h) OR'ed together.
◆ enableFaultSourceCoreLockup
| bool TIMER_InitDTI_TypeDef::enableFaultSourceCoreLockup |
Enable core lockup as a fault source.
◆ enableFaultSourceDebugger
| bool TIMER_InitDTI_TypeDef::enableFaultSourceDebugger |
Enable debugger as a fault source.
◆ enableFaultSourcePrsSel0
| bool TIMER_InitDTI_TypeDef::enableFaultSourcePrsSel0 |
Enable PRS fault source 0 (
faultSourcePrsSel0
).
◆ faultSourcePrsSel0
| TIMER_PRSSEL_TypeDef TIMER_InitDTI_TypeDef::faultSourcePrsSel0 |
Select which PRS signal to be PRS fault source 0.
◆ enableFaultSourcePrsSel1
| bool TIMER_InitDTI_TypeDef::enableFaultSourcePrsSel1 |
Enable PRS fault source 1 (
faultSourcePrsSel1
).
◆ faultSourcePrsSel1
| TIMER_PRSSEL_TypeDef TIMER_InitDTI_TypeDef::faultSourcePrsSel1 |
Select which PRS signal to be PRS fault source 1.
◆ faultAction
| TIMER_DtiFaultAction_TypeDef TIMER_InitDTI_TypeDef::faultAction |
Fault Action.
